namespace {

#if BUILDFLAG(IS_WIN)
bool ShouldDisableDohForWindowsParentalControls() {
  return GetWinParentalControls().web_filter;
}

// Defines the base::Feature for controlling the ZTDNS check.
BASE_FEATURE(kZeroTrustDNS, base::FEATURE_ENABLED_BY_DEFAULT);

// DnsIsZtEnabled returns a BOOL value that specifies whether Zero
// Trust DNS (ZTDNS) is enabled on the current device.
using DnsIsZtEnabledFunc = BOOL (*)();

// Applicable to Windows OS.
// Returns true if Zero Trust DNS is enabled at the OS level.
// Returns false if Zero Trust DNS is either not enabled or unsupported.
bool IsZTDNSEnabled() {
  if (StubResolverConfigReader::IsZTDNSEnabledForTesting()) {
    return true;
  }

  if (!base::FeatureList::IsEnabled(kZeroTrustDNS)) {
    return false;
  }

  // DnsIsZtEnabled returns a BOOL value that specifies whether Zero
  // Trust DNS (ZTDNS) is enabled on the current device.
  // There is no import library for this function, thus using native
  // dnsapi.dll library.
  const wchar_t* dll_name = L"dnsapi.dll";
  const char* function_name = "DnsIsZtEnabled";
  auto dns_api_dll = base::ScopedNativeLibrary(base::FilePath(dll_name));

  if (!dns_api_dll.is_valid()) {
    return false;
  }

  auto dns_is_zt_enabled_func = reinterpret_cast<DnsIsZtEnabledFunc>(
      dns_api_dll.GetFunctionPointer(function_name));

  if (!dns_is_zt_enabled_func) {
    const base::win::OSInfo* os_info = base::win::OSInfo::GetInstance();
    auto os_info_version = os_info->version();
    auto os_info_version_number = os_info->version_number();

    DCHECK(!(os_info_version > base::win::Version::WIN11_24H2 ||
             (os_info_version == base::win::Version::WIN11_24H2 &&
              os_info_version_number.build >= 27766)))
        << function_name
        << " not found, but it was expected on this OS version: "
        << "Major: " << os_info_version_number.major
        << ", Minor: " << os_info_version_number.minor
        << ", Build: " << os_info_version_number.build
        << " (Comparing against > WIN11_24H2 or WIN11_24H2 with build >= "
           "27766)";
    return false;
  }
  return dns_is_zt_enabled_func();
}
#endif  // BUILDFLAG(IS_WIN)

// Check the AsyncDns field trial and return true if it should be enabled. On
// Android this includes checking the Android version in the field trial.
bool ShouldEnableAsyncDns() {
#if BUILDFLAG(IS_WIN)
  // On Windows if Zero Trust DNS is enabled on current device,
  // we should not use built-in resolver (async dns). It should
  // always use system (OS) resolver.
  if (IsZTDNSEnabled()) {
    return false;
  }
#endif
  bool feature_can_be_enabled = true;
#if BUILDFLAG(IS_ANDROID)
  int min_sdk = base::GetFieldTrialParamByFeatureAsInt(net::features::kAsyncDns,
                                                       "min_sdk", 0);
  if (base::android::android_info::sdk_int() < min_sdk) {
    feature_can_be_enabled = false;
  }
#endif
  return feature_can_be_enabled &&
         base::FeatureList::IsEnabled(net::features::kAsyncDns);
}

// Returns whether the Secure DNS DoH fallback behavior should be used.
bool ShouldUseDohFallback(net::SecureDnsMode secure_dns_mode,
                          const DnsOverHttpsConfigSource& doh_config_source) {
  // DoH fallback is only applicable to Automatic mode.
  if (secure_dns_mode != net::SecureDnsMode::kAutomatic) {
    return false;
  }

  // If the feature is enabled then return the boolean value of the pref.
  // DoH fallback is a new setting introduced in the Bundled Security Settings
  // for Secure DNS. If the new UI is enabled to make the setting available,
  // then just check user choice in the pref.
  if (base::FeatureList::IsEnabled(
          safe_browsing::kBundledSecuritySettingsSecureDnsV2)) {
    return doh_config_source.AutomaticModeFallbackToDohEnabled();
  }

  return false;
}

// For insecure DNS resolution in Chrome, enables the usage of platform DNS
// APIs, instead of Chrome's built-in DNS client.
BASE_FEATURE(kChromeEnableDnsPlatform, base::FEATURE_DISABLED_BY_DEFAULT);
BASE_FEATURE_PARAM(bool,
                   kChromeEnableDnsPlatformNoSystem,
                   &kChromeEnableDnsPlatform,
                   "no_system",
                   false);

}  // namespace

SecureDnsConfig StubResolverConfigReader::GetAndUpdateConfiguration(
    bool force_check_parental_controls_for_automatic_mode,
    bool record_metrics,
    bool update_network_service) {
  DCHECK_CALLED_ON_VALID_SEQUENCE(sequence_checker_);

  net::SecureDnsMode secure_dns_mode;
  SecureDnsModeDetailsForHistogram mode_details;
  SecureDnsConfig::ManagementMode forced_management_mode =
      SecureDnsConfig::ManagementMode::kNoOverride;
  bool is_managed = GetDnsOverHttpsConfigSource()->IsConfigManaged();
  if (!is_managed && ShouldDisableDohForManaged()) {
    secure_dns_mode = net::SecureDnsMode::kOff;
    forced_management_mode = SecureDnsConfig::ManagementMode::kDisabledManaged;
  } else {
    secure_dns_mode = SecureDnsConfig::ParseMode(
                          GetDnsOverHttpsConfigSource()->GetDnsOverHttpsMode())
                          .value_or(net::SecureDnsMode::kOff);
  }

  bool check_parental_controls = false;
  if (secure_dns_mode == net::SecureDnsMode::kSecure) {
    mode_details =
        is_managed ? SecureDnsModeDetailsForHistogram::kSecureByEnterprisePolicy
                   : SecureDnsModeDetailsForHistogram::kSecureByUser;

    // SECURE mode must always check for parental controls immediately (unless
    // enabled through policy, which takes precedence over parental controls)
    // because the mode allows sending DoH requests immediately.
    check_parental_controls = !is_managed;
  } else if (secure_dns_mode == net::SecureDnsMode::kAutomatic) {
    mode_details =
        is_managed
            ? SecureDnsModeDetailsForHistogram::kAutomaticByEnterprisePolicy
            : SecureDnsModeDetailsForHistogram::kAutomaticByUser;

    // To avoid impacting startup performance, AUTOMATIC mode should defer
    // checking parental for a short period. This delay should have no practical
    // effect on DoH queries because DoH enabling probes do not start until a
    // longer period after startup.
    bool allow_check_parental_controls =
        force_check_parental_controls_for_automatic_mode ||
        parental_controls_checked_;
    check_parental_controls = !is_managed && allow_check_parental_controls;
  } else {
    switch (forced_management_mode) {
      case SecureDnsConfig::ManagementMode::kNoOverride:
        mode_details =
            is_managed
                ? SecureDnsModeDetailsForHistogram::kOffByEnterprisePolicy
                : SecureDnsModeDetailsForHistogram::kOffByUser;
        break;
      case SecureDnsConfig::ManagementMode::kDisabledManaged:
        mode_details =
            SecureDnsModeDetailsForHistogram::kOffByDetectedManagedEnvironment;
        break;
      case SecureDnsConfig::ManagementMode::kDisabledParentalControls:
        NOTREACHED();
      default:
        NOTREACHED();
    }

    // No need to check for parental controls if DoH is already disabled.
    check_parental_controls = false;
  }

  // Check parental controls last because it can be expensive and should only be
  // checked if necessary for the otherwise-determined mode.
  if (check_parental_controls) {
    if (ShouldDisableDohForParentalControls()) {
      forced_management_mode =
          SecureDnsConfig::ManagementMode::kDisabledParentalControls;
      secure_dns_mode = net::SecureDnsMode::kOff;
      mode_details =
          SecureDnsModeDetailsForHistogram::kOffByDetectedParentalControls;

      // If parental controls had not previously been checked, need to update
      // network service.
      if (!parental_controls_checked_)
        update_network_service = true;
    }

    parental_controls_checked_ = true;
  }

  bool additional_dns_query_types_enabled =
      local_state_->GetBoolean(prefs::kAdditionalDnsQueryTypesEnabled);

  net::DnsOverHttpsConfig doh_config;
  std::vector<net::IPEndPoint> fallback_doh_nameservers;
  if (secure_dns_mode != net::SecureDnsMode::kOff) {
    doh_config = net::DnsOverHttpsConfig::FromStringLax(
        GetDnsOverHttpsConfigSource()->GetDnsOverHttpsTemplates());
    if (ShouldUseDohFallback(secure_dns_mode,
                             *GetDnsOverHttpsConfigSource())) {
      mode_details =
          SecureDnsModeDetailsForHistogram::kAutomaticWithDohFallbackByUser;
      fallback_doh_nameservers = GetFallbackDohNameservers();
    }
  }

  if (record_metrics) {
    UMA_HISTOGRAM_ENUMERATION("Net.DNS.DnsConfig.SecureDnsMode", mode_details);
    if (!additional_dns_query_types_enabled || ShouldDisableDohForManaged()) {
      UMA_HISTOGRAM_BOOLEAN("Net.DNS.DnsConfig.AdditionalDnsQueryTypesEnabled",
                            additional_dns_query_types_enabled);
    }
  }

  if (update_network_service) {
    net::InsecureDnsMode insecure_dns_mode = net::InsecureDnsMode::kDisabled;
    if (GetInsecureStubResolverEnabled()) {
      if (net::features::IsDnsPlatformSupported() &&
          base::FeatureList::IsEnabled(kChromeEnableDnsPlatform)) {
        insecure_dns_mode = kChromeEnableDnsPlatformNoSystem.Get()
                                ? net::InsecureDnsMode::kEnabledPlatformNoSystem
                                : net::InsecureDnsMode::kEnabledPlatform;
      } else {
        insecure_dns_mode = net::InsecureDnsMode::kEnabledBuiltIn;
      }
    }
    content::GetNetworkService()->ConfigureStubHostResolver(
        insecure_dns_mode, GetHappyEyeballsV3Enabled(), secure_dns_mode,
        doh_config, additional_dns_query_types_enabled,
        fallback_doh_nameservers);
  }

  return SecureDnsConfig(secure_dns_mode, std::move(doh_config),
                         forced_management_mode,
                         std::move(fallback_doh_nameservers));
}
